Chuck E Cheese Creative Brief
- 1. Client: Chuck E. Cheese Date: 7-13-11
Project: Brand campaign
Job Number: 4
WHY ARE WE ADVERTISING?
With video games and cable TV, kids are losing interest in the old arcade-style places. Additionally, Chuck E.
Cheese has lost a lot of their cool factor, with places like GameWorks popping up all over.
WHAT IS THE ADVERTISING TRYING TO ACCOMPLISH?
To convince kids that Chuck E. Cheese is still a fun place to go.
WHO ARE WE TALKING TO?
Boys and girls ages 8 to 11. We can’t alienate the parents with the advertising, but at this age, kids are smart
enough to select their own entertainment destinations.
WHAT IS THE ONE MAIN POINT WE’RE TRYING TO GET ACROSS?
Convince kids that Chuck E. Cheese is a great place to go.
WHAT ARE THE REASONS TO BELIEVE THIS?
Chuck E. Cheese does have a lot of new, hard-to-find games. While not as hip as a GameWorks, it does cater only
to kids, so they don’t have to worry about fighting teens and adults for game time. And since it’s a pizza place with
entertainment as well, it’s more of a destination than GameWorks.
